Output 50e13632278d91b5e06eb32b600c5c6f5e9bbf1edf3b18a998d284f96b21a5f8:1

value
958238403
script pubkey
OP_0 OP_PUSHBYTES_20 f5a0ec8aa86b04ddc35d05c8e691980ee5e817be
address
ltc1q7kswez4gdvzdms6aqhywdyvcpmj7s9a7npcqmv
transaction
50e13632278d91b5e06eb32b600c5c6f5e9bbf1edf3b18a998d284f96b21a5f8
spent
true